The low mounted front turning lights was a feature of the first version of the VW T2 now referred to as the T2a. The T2a was manufactured from autumn 1967 to summer of 1972 (MY 1968-1972). The T2a also had the taillights of the last version of the T1. The high mounted front turning lights were introduced the autumn of 1972 (MY 1973) and used until 1979. Now referred to as the T2b. The T2b got new larger taillights with integrated reversing lights, larger „square“ bumpers, an improved front crash protection structure and more.
